Output 9904b93f656dacd623f9ede8c5bbb20aede27ae2c127a28ebc1908d3a413b250:1

value
28542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6bdc2e89ebceabc6e53a773f81b95bebf71a41 OP_EQUAL
address
3HVz2yphgzH6oUqab1ofCQNzi15pnuL3u7
transaction
9904b93f656dacd623f9ede8c5bbb20aede27ae2c127a28ebc1908d3a413b250
confirmations
307967
spent
true